Ben Martin is on the pastoral team of Pioneer Memorial Church on the campus of Andrews University where he is the Pastor for Children and Family Discipleship. He is passionate about engaging youth in ministry. He believes that every member should be a functioning part of the body of Christ. Over the last few years he has been intentionally thinking through what it means to disciple the next generation. He enjoys photography, camping and spending time with his wife, Brianna. Together, they have 2 children.

Honduras Mission Team

The PMC Youth Missions trip to Honduras will take place January 2-13. The team will conduct a Friendship Camp with the children of the Hogar de Niños (children's home) and the surrounding community. Additionally we will lead worship services, community projects and lots of activities for the children and youth. Space for a few more volunteers is available. For more information please email Glenn Russell at glenn@andrews.edu
